Lines Matching +full:gpio +full:- +full:width
4 * SPDX-License-Identifier: Apache-2.0
8 #include <arm/armv7-r.dtsi>
9 #include <zephyr/dt-bindings/interrupt-controller/arm-gic.h>
10 #include <zephyr/dt-bindings/ethernet/xlnx_gem.h>
15 compatible = "soc-nv-flash";
20 compatible = "mmio-sram";
25 compatible = "zephyr,memory-region", "xlnx,zynq-ocm";
27 zephyr,memory-region = "OCM";
36 interrupt-names = "irq_0";
45 interrupt-names = "irq_0";
57 interrupt-names = "irq_0", "irq_1", "irq_2";
70 interrupt-names = "irq_0", "irq_1", "irq_2";
83 interrupt-names = "irq_0", "irq_1", "irq_2";
96 interrupt-names = "irq_0", "irq_1", "irq_2";
109 interrupt-names = "irq_0", "irq_1";
110 mdio-phy-address = <XLNX_GEM_PHY_AUTO_DETECT>;
111 phy-poll-interval = <1000>;
112 link-speed = <XLNX_GEM_LINK_SPEED_100MBIT>;
113 amba-ahb-dbus-width = <XLNX_GEM_AMBA_AHB_DBUS_WIDTH_32BIT>;
114 amba-ahb-burst-length = <XLNX_GEM_AMBA_AHB_BURST_SINGLE>;
115 hw-rx-buffer-size = <XLNX_GEM_HW_RX_BUFFER_SIZE_8KB>;
116 hw-rx-buffer-offset = <0>;
117 hw-tx-buffer-size-full;
118 rx-buffer-descriptors = <32>;
119 tx-buffer-descriptors = <32>;
120 rx-buffer-size = <512>;
121 tx-buffer-size = <512>;
122 discard-rx-fcs;
123 unicast-hash;
124 full-duplex;
136 interrupt-names = "irq_0", "irq_1";
137 mdio-phy-address = <XLNX_GEM_PHY_AUTO_DETECT>;
138 phy-poll-interval = <1000>;
139 link-speed = <XLNX_GEM_LINK_SPEED_100MBIT>;
140 amba-ahb-dbus-width = <XLNX_GEM_AMBA_AHB_DBUS_WIDTH_32BIT>;
141 amba-ahb-burst-length = <XLNX_GEM_AMBA_AHB_BURST_SINGLE>;
142 hw-rx-buffer-size = <XLNX_GEM_HW_RX_BUFFER_SIZE_8KB>;
143 hw-rx-buffer-offset = <0>;
144 hw-tx-buffer-size-full;
145 rx-buffer-descriptors = <32>;
146 tx-buffer-descriptors = <32>;
147 rx-buffer-size = <512>;
148 tx-buffer-size = <512>;
149 discard-rx-fcs;
150 unicast-hash;
151 full-duplex;
163 interrupt-names = "irq_0", "irq_1";
164 mdio-phy-address = <XLNX_GEM_PHY_AUTO_DETECT>;
165 phy-poll-interval = <1000>;
166 link-speed = <XLNX_GEM_LINK_SPEED_100MBIT>;
167 amba-ahb-dbus-width = <XLNX_GEM_AMBA_AHB_DBUS_WIDTH_32BIT>;
168 amba-ahb-burst-length = <XLNX_GEM_AMBA_AHB_BURST_SINGLE>;
169 hw-rx-buffer-size = <XLNX_GEM_HW_RX_BUFFER_SIZE_8KB>;
170 hw-rx-buffer-offset = <0>;
171 hw-tx-buffer-size-full;
172 rx-buffer-descriptors = <32>;
173 tx-buffer-descriptors = <32>;
174 rx-buffer-size = <512>;
175 tx-buffer-size = <512>;
176 discard-rx-fcs;
177 unicast-hash;
178 full-duplex;
190 interrupt-names = "irq_0", "irq_1";
191 mdio-phy-address = <XLNX_GEM_PHY_AUTO_DETECT>;
192 phy-poll-interval = <1000>;
193 link-speed = <XLNX_GEM_LINK_SPEED_100MBIT>;
194 amba-ahb-dbus-width = <XLNX_GEM_AMBA_AHB_DBUS_WIDTH_32BIT>;
195 amba-ahb-burst-length = <XLNX_GEM_AMBA_AHB_BURST_SINGLE>;
196 hw-rx-buffer-size = <XLNX_GEM_HW_RX_BUFFER_SIZE_8KB>;
197 hw-rx-buffer-offset = <0>;
198 hw-tx-buffer-size-full;
199 rx-buffer-descriptors = <32>;
200 tx-buffer-descriptors = <32>;
201 rx-buffer-size = <512>;
202 tx-buffer-size = <512>;
203 discard-rx-fcs;
204 unicast-hash;
205 full-duplex;
208 psgpio: gpio@ff0a0000 {
209 compatible = "xlnx,ps-gpio";
214 interrupt-names = "irq_0";
216 #address-cells = <1>;
217 #size-cells = <0>;
220 compatible = "xlnx,ps-gpio-bank";
222 gpio-controller;
223 #gpio-cells = <2>;
229 compatible = "xlnx,ps-gpio-bank";
231 gpio-controller;
232 #gpio-cells = <2>;
238 compatible = "xlnx,ps-gpio-bank";
240 gpio-controller;
241 #gpio-cells = <2>;
247 compatible = "xlnx,ps-gpio-bank";
249 gpio-controller;
250 #gpio-cells = <2>;
256 compatible = "xlnx,ps-gpio-bank";
258 gpio-controller;
259 #gpio-cells = <2>;
265 compatible = "xlnx,ps-gpio-bank";
267 gpio-controller;
268 #gpio-cells = <2>;